Each race has a different focus on ship classes - Tarka should specialise in cruiser sized vessels, Humans and Morrigi in Dreadnaught sized vessels, Hiver's used to have very effective destroyers so not sure how that will work in SOTS ][ unless its the DE sized battleriders (which are heavily armed). In the same way in SOTs prime Humans had very effective and cheap dreadnaughts - I would not expect them to shift this into LV's in SOTS ][ but remain with their primary racial bonus on Dreads. Morrigi have very effective Dreadnaughts - and this could well counteract/balance a weaker Leviathon, although there leviathons are amoung the cheapest to produce.

There is no set end of game race - the Zuul have been balanced with access to Suul'ka, and through the Suul'ka the ability to gain any tech they fancy (at a price) - now Zuul with Adamantine armour and meson beams? I would suggest refraining from final judgement until all the features are in and we can see how the races balance out :)

The game is slower, more sedate; i think they're expecting a longer end-game, which would ruin the Suul'ka Horde as a faction if they still ran out of steam midgame.

to be honest, though, the Zuul get Suul'ka, Suul'ka tech and movement (Suul'ka can relocate to any star, as well as of course take Zuul with them off the node lines); the Liir have the Black, battleships, the Zuul battleriders providing serious firepower (Zuul ships with Liir tech...). the Morrigi have drones, which are more important now, and battleriders in a way nobody else does (that LV mounts like a third again as many BRs as anyone else's, for less cash). Solforce, I haven't played as, but let's be honest, just making the node ring not a massive target any more is going to bolster them no end. I suspect the assessment of their LVs above may be wrong, too; the humans invented the Leviathan class, after all... The Hivers have gate stations now - considerably harder to kill than even a decently-armoured cruiser gate, i suspect - and the gate network has become even MORE of an advantage now that ships return to base after missions.

in short, i think every race is more powerful now, their styles of combat more developed and focussed. they might not be balanced, yet, but i can certainly see how to balance them.
